My next bit of information is about video connections. DVI is a new~ish interface for video, but it's already being replaced on the high end by HDMI. HDMI is a smaller, more compact cable than DVI, but actually has room to transfer more information, and it can include audio.
Two good articles I found basically said it was a good interface, but that most devices today only transfer simple 2 channel audio. And, there hasn't been any adoption in the computer market yet. Based on the quote below from AnandTech, HDMI has copy protection baked in, so we're likely going to see it overtake DVI over the next couple of years.
